"Wie wird man Programmierer?"

Frag Robi

Robis Antwort auf die Frage

"Wie wird man Programmierer?"

Der Weg zum Programmierer ist so vielfältig wie die Programmiersprachen selbst. Bereits Jugendliche beginnen oft damit, eigene kleine Programme zu schreiben oder Webseiten zu gestalten. Doch um professioneller Programmierer zu werden, bedarf es einer gezielten Ausbildung und stetigen Weiterbildung. Zum einen gibt es die klassische akademische Laufbahn, die einen durch ein Informatikstudium führt und mit einem Bachelor- oder Masterabschluss endet. Viele Universitäten und Fachhochschulen bieten entsprechende Studiengänge an.

Zum anderen kann man auch über einen nicht-akademischen Weg in die Branche einsteigen. Hierzu zählen Ausbildungsberufe wie Fachinformatiker für Anwendungsentwicklung oder Systemintegration. Doch auch Quereinsteiger haben gute Chancen, wenn sie fundierte Kenntnisse in relevanten Programmiersprachen und Technologien vorweisen können. Hierbei helfen Online-Kurse, Workshops oder Bootcamps, die intensiv und praxisnah Wissen vermitteln.

Unabhängig vom gewählten Weg ist jedoch eines klar: Programmieren lernt man am besten durch Praxis. Dies bedeutet, viel zu coden, Projekte zu begleiten und aus Fehlern zu lernen. Der ständige Wandel der Technologien erfordert darüber hinaus lebenslanges Lernen und eine hohe Anpassungsfähigkeit.

Bisher haben wir die Frage

"Wie wird man Programmierer?"

mindestens 5x erhalten. Hier die letzten 5 Fragen:



CodeMaster92

Welchen Weg sollte man einschlagen, um ein erfolgreicher Softwareentwickler zu werden?

CodeMaster92 // 14.06.2021
SelfTaughtGenius

Kann man auch ohne Studium ein guter Programmierer sein?

SelfTaughtGenius // 25.12.2022
ByteBeginner

Welche Programmiersprachen sollte man als Anfänger lernen?

ByteBeginner // 03.03.2023
InternetScholar

Was sind die besten Online-Ressourcen, um das Programmieren zu lernen?

InternetScholar // 11.11.2021
UniOrNotUni

Muss ich ein IT-Studium absolvieren, um als Programmierer zu arbeiten?

UniOrNotUni // 29.08.2022

Das sagen andere Nutzer zu dem Thema

CodeMaster404
CodeMaster404
03.02.2024

Um Programmierer zu werden, ist es hilfreich, sich zuerst die Grundlagen der Informatik und Programmierung anzueignen, z.B. durch Online-Kurse, Tutorials oder ein Studium. Praxiserfahrung durch eigene Projekte oder Praktika ist ebenfalls sehr wichtig.

QuickBoot3000
QuickBoot3000
03.02.2024

Ich bin durch Bootcamps zum Programmierer geworden. Diese intensiven Kurse konzentrieren sich darauf, dir in kurzer Zeit viel praxisrelevantes Wissen zu vermitteln. Super für Quereinsteiger oder wenn es schnell gehen muss!

TechGuru92
TechGuru92
03.02.2024

Eine solide Basis in einer Programmiersprache wie Python oder Java ist wichtig. Danach würde ich mich auf spezifische Technologien oder Fachgebiete konzentrieren, die dich interessieren, wie z.B. Webentwicklung oder Datenanalyse.

Ausführliche Antwort zu

"Wie wird man Programmierer?"


Einstieg in die Programmierung

Der erste Schritt zum Erlernen der Programmierung ist oft der spielerische Umgang mit Code. Plattformen wie Scratch oder einfache Tutorials in Python ermöglichen es, erste Erfahrungen zu sammeln und kleine Projekte zu realisieren. Wichtig ist es, Neugier und Spaß am Tüfteln zu fördern, denn diese Eigenschaften sind für Programmierer essentiell.

Akademische vs. nicht-akademische Wege

Nach ersten Erfahrungen stellt sich die Frage nach dem weiteren Werdegang. Während ein Informatikstudium an einer Universität tiefgreifendes Wissen in vielen Bereichen der Computertechnologie und theoretische Grundlagen vermittelt, sind die nicht-akademischen Pfade oft pragmatischer und stärker auf direkte berufliche Einsatzfähigkeit fokussiert. Die Wahl des Weges hängt von persönlichen Präferenzen, der gewünschten Spezialisierung und der Lebenssituation ab.

Ausbildungsberufe und Studiengänge

Für diejenigen, die eine praxisnahe Ausbildung bevorzugen, ist eine Ausbildung zum Fachinformatiker eine gute Wahl. Studiengänge wie Softwareentwicklung oder Angewandte Informatik bieten hingegen ein breites Spektrum akademischen Wissens gepaart mit praktischen Semestern in Unternehmen. Auch hier ist die Kombination von Theorie und Praxis für den erfolgreichen Berufseinstieg wichtig.

Wichtigkeit von Praxiserfahrung

Unabhängig vom Bildungsweg ist Praxiserfahrung unabdingbar. Schon während der Ausbildung sollten angehende Programmierer an eigenen Projekten arbeiten oder an Open-Source-Projekten mitwirken. Praxis schärft das technische Verständnis, fördert das Problemlösevermögen und hilft dabei, gängige Entwicklertools zu meistern.

Fortbildung und Spezialisierung

Technologie wandelt sich rapide, und dementsprechend muss das Wissen eines Programmierers aktuell gehalten werden. Fortbildungen, Fachkonferenzen und Online-Kurse sind essentiell, um up-to-date zu bleiben. Spezialisierungen, zum Beispiel in künstlicher Intelligenz, Cloud Computing oder Cybersecurity, können die beruflichen Chancen verbessern und gehaltvolle Nischen bieten. Letztlich ist es die Kombination aus solidem Grundwissen, ständiger Lernbereitschaft und Spezialisierung, die einen erfolgreichen Programmierer ausmacht.

Online-Ressourcen und Selbststudium

Die Welt der Programmierung ist stets in Bewegung, und es entstehen kontinuierlich neue Lernmöglichkeiten. Online-Plattformen wie Coursera, edX und Udemy bieten ein reichhaltiges Angebot an Kursen für Anfänger bis hin zu Fortgeschrittenen. Programmier-Interessierte können sich mithilfe von Video-Tutorials, interaktiven Übungen und Community-Diskussionen Wissen aneignen. Das Selbststudium erfordert Disziplin und Motivation, doch die Flexibilität, das eigene Lernen zu gestalten, ist ein großer Vorteil. Es empfiehlt sich, regelmäßig verschiedene Quellen zu Rate zu ziehen, um ein breites Verständnis der Materie zu entwickeln.

Die Rolle von Zertifikaten

Zertifikate können als Beleg für die erlernten Fähigkeiten dienen, besonders wenn man keinen formalen Abschluss in Informatik besitzt. Sie zeigen potenziellen Arbeitgebern, dass man sich mit spezifischen Technologien oder Methoden auseinandergesetzt hat. Viele Online-Kurse enden mit der Vergabe eines Zertifikats, welches die erworbenen Kompetenzen dokumentiert. Zertifikate von renommierten Anbietern oder spezialisierten Technologieunternehmen haben oft einen hohen Stellenwert in der Branche.

Netzwerke und Communitys

Der Austausch mit Gleichgesinnten und Fachexperten ist entscheidend für die berufliche Entwicklung. Netzwerkveranstaltungen, Meetups und Konferenzen bieten hervorragende Möglichkeiten, um wertvolle Kontakte zu knüpfen und von den Erfahrungen anderer zu lernen. Online-Communitys und Foren wie Stack Overflow oder GitHub geben zudem die Chance, sich an Open-Source-Projekten zu beteiligen und Feedback sowie Anerkennung aus der Community zu erhalten.

Finden des ersten Programmier-Jobs

Ein guter Lebenslauf und überzeugende Projektarbeiten sind die Visitenkarte für den Einstieg in den Beruf. Es ist sinnvoll, Praktika oder Werkstudentenpositionen während des Studiums oder der Ausbildung anzustreben, um Berufserfahrung zu sammeln. Freelancing kann ebenfalls eine Option sein, um erste Referenzen zu erarbeiten. Jobportale, Karrieremessen und das eigene berufliche Netzwerk sind essenzielle Hilfen bei der Jobsuche.

Trends und Zukunftsaussichten

Technologische Entwicklungen wie die Blockchain-Technologie, das Internet der Dinge (IoT) oder maschinelles Lernen treiben den Bedarf an spezialisierten Programmierkompetenzen voran. Programmierer, die sich in diesen aufstrebenden Bereichen weiterbilden, können ihre Karriereaussichten signifikant verbessern. Es ist wichtig, am Puls der Zeit zu bleiben, regelmäßig über neue Trends zu lesen und sich fortzubilden, um langfristig in der sich schnell entwickelnden Welt der Technologie erfolgreich zu sein.




Weiterführende Links

Hier noch 10 Fragen